Dream meaning Babies

Dreaming of babies can carry a wide range of symbolic meanings depending on the context of the dream and your personal life. Babies are often associated with new beginnings, innocence, and potential. Here are some common interpretations:


1. New Beginnings and Potential

  • Babies often symbolize a fresh start, new opportunities, or the birth of an idea, project, or phase in your life.

2. Innocence and Vulnerability

  • A baby may represent purity, innocence, or the vulnerable side of yourself that needs nurturing and protection.

3. Creativity and Growth

  • A baby could signify creativity, representing an idea or project in its infancy that needs care and attention to grow.

4. Responsibility and Care

  • Dreaming of caring for a baby may indicate a sense of responsibility or the need to nurture something in your waking life.

5. Inner Child

  • A baby in your dream might symbolize your inner child, reflecting unresolved issues from childhood or a need to reconnect with playful or carefree aspects of yourself.

6. Anxiety or Insecurity

  • If the dream involves a crying or distressed baby, it may reflect feelings of neglect, insecurity, or unmet needs.

7. Transition or Transformation

  • Babies often represent the start of a transformative journey or the emergence of a new aspect of your personality.

Common Scenarios and Their Meanings:

  1. Holding a Baby: Embracing new responsibilities, opportunities, or nurturing qualities.
  2. Losing a Baby: Fear of losing something precious or anxiety about failure in a new endeavor.
  3. Crying Baby: Indicates unresolved emotional needs or stress.
  4. Happy Baby: Symbolizes joy, fulfillment, or optimism about new beginnings.
  5. Having Twins: Reflects dual opportunities, choices, or contrasting aspects of a situation.
  6. Birth of a Baby: Represents the start of something new or significant change.
